Morroco: Donkeys, alcohol hard to get, marijuana very easy to get, a lot of children, barking dogs, cats, beautiful nature, very kind people.

We took the ferry from Tarifa to Tanger. The first question that the Moroccan customs asked, "do you have a drone". Luckily we were informed that a drone is strictly forbidden in Morocco, so we stored the drone at a camping in Spain.

In Tanger we ordered lunch. After finishing a huge plate of shrimps I wanted to pay, but it seems that this was just the starter. The main course was another plate full with fried fish and that for only €8😜. 

Next stop was Martil. Here we found out that the supermarket Carrefour sells wine and beer. Hard to find, a hidden store (no signs) behind the supermarket. For Islam people it is forbidden to buy and drink alcohol.

This was our last stop in Morocco. On our way to the ferry we did some shopping at a supermarket. Jurgen was interested in a English version of the Qur-an. We couldn't find the price. A lady with a Niqab asked if she could help. She spoke Dutch. Jurgen told her that he was interested and want to know the price. She said, "I want to give you the book, please" and she gave him 200 dhm (€20).
